Market Analysis

According to The Cyr Team’s weekly market analysis, the current real estate landscape in the **William Penn School District** is quite active, with **66 homes** currently listed for sale. The median price for these properties stands at **$239,450**, while the average price is slightly higher at **$282,364**. Prices span a wide range from **$59,900 to $899,900**, and homes are spending an average of **82 days** on the market before securing a buyer.

With **2.4 months** of inventory available, the market in the **William Penn School District** favors sellers, though there are signs of adjustments happening. Notably, **28 homes** or **42.4%** of the active listings have seen price reductions, indicating that while demand is present, buyers may be looking for deals which suggests some price sensitivity in the current climate. What townships and neighborhoods are in William Penn School District?

William Penn School District includes Lansdowne Borough, Yeadon Borough, Darby Borough, Aldan Borough.

Local News & Community Updates


Pennsylvania’s budget impasse is affecting schools. William Penn School District could run out of money within months

Link: https://whyy.org/articles/william-penn-school-district-funding-pennsylvania-b…

Pennsylvania’s budget impasse is threatening the financial stability of the William Penn School District in Delaware County, which could run out of funds within months, impacting local schools and potentially affecting property values in the district.
